When a clutch fails to properly engage or disengage the transmission (gear box), the vehicle may possibly slip out of gear or struggle to remain in equipment when it accelerates. This is named clutch slipping.

In 1962, Chrysler launched a starter incorporating a geartrain between the motor and the drive shaft. The motor shaft bundled integrally Lower equipment enamel forming a pinion that meshes get more info with a bigger adjacent pushed gear to deliver a gear reduction ratio of 3.75:1. This permitted the usage of an increased-velocity, reduced-existing, lighter plus much more compact motor assembly while increasing cranking torque.
